The ZTE ZXD3000 is a high-efficiency switching-mode rectifier module used primarily in telecommunication power systems to convert AC power into stable 48V DC power. Product Overview
The ZXD3000 serves as the core power unit for mobile base stations and exchange facilities. It is designed for high power density (up to 29.9 W/in³) and energy efficiency, often exceeding 96% peak efficiency. Core Technical Specifications Rated Output Power: 3000 W.
Rated Output Voltage: -53.5 V DC (adjustable range: -41.5 V to -58.5 V).
Input Voltage Range: 75 V AC to 295 V AC (supports a wide grid adaptability). Input Frequency: 45 Hz to 66 Hz.
Operating Temperature: -40°C to +75°C (full output power typically up to +45°C or +55°C depending on specific sub-version). Weight: Approximately 2.0 kg. Dimensions (W×H×D): 132 mm × 41.5 mm × 300 mm. Key Manual Features & Functions zxd 3000 user manual

The ZXD3000 User Manual (often specifically for the V5.0 or V5.5 models) is a technical document provided by ZTE to support its high-efficiency telecom rectifier module. The manual is essential for engineers and maintenance personnel working with 48V DC power systems. Manual Content Overview
The documentation typically covers several critical areas to ensure safe and efficient operation of the 3000W rectifier:
Component Descriptions: Detailed breakdowns of the front panel, including the QUY button for manual status inquiries and the four LED status indicators (Power, Run, Alarm, and Fault).
Installation & Removal: Instructions on using the built-in wrench to secure or hot-swap modules within a power rack.
Technical Specifications: Deep dives into the unit’s performance, such as its 96.3% peak efficiency, wide input voltage range (70V to 300V AC), and operating temperature limits (-40°C to +75°C).
Monitoring & Control: Guidance on using the CAN bus interface for digital communication with a Centralized Supervision Unit (CSU).
Protection Functions: Documentation of built-in safeguards like overvoltage, undervoltage, and over-temperature protection. Critical User Feedback & Utility

is a high-efficiency, switching-mode rectifier module designed for telecommunications power systems
. It converts AC power into a stable 48V DC output to power communication equipment and charge battery banks. Hebei Kelingyizhi Communication Technology Co., Ltd. Key Technical Specifications Output Power: Input Voltage: Supports a wide range from 80 V to 300 V AC Output Voltage: -53.5 V DC (adjustable range: -42 V to -59.5 V DC). Efficiency: Peak efficiency can reach up to Operating Temperature: Built for extreme environments, ranging from -40°C to +75°C Hardware Features & Indicators
The front panel includes several key components for operation and monitoring: Indicators:
Four LEDs (Power, Alarm, Operation, and Fault) to show real-time module status. QUY Button:
A "one-key inquiry" button that allows you to quickly view operating data and fault information on the system's monitoring unit.
Uses intelligent forced air cooling (fans) that adjust speed based on internal temperature. Hot-Swappable:
Designed for easy replacement without powering down the entire system. Core Functions Load Sharing:
Automatically balances output current when multiple modules are used in parallel (supports up to 40 units). Battery Management:
Integrated logic for charging and maintaining battery packs within the ZXDU series power systems Hibernation Mode:
To save energy during low-load periods, the module can enter a sleep mode where consumption drops below Protections:
Includes built-in safeguards against over-voltage, over-temperature, over-current, and short circuits. Manual & Documentation Resources SJ-20141208170916-001-ZXD3000 (V5.5) Rectifier ... - Scribd
ZXD 3000 User Manual: Installation, Operation, and Troubleshooting
The ZXD 3000 is a high-efficiency, digitizing rectifier designed specifically for modern telecommunication power systems. Known for its compact "hot-swap" design and impressive power density, it is a staple in 48V DC power solutions.
This guide serves as a comprehensive overview of the ZXD 3000 user manual, covering everything from technical specifications to routine maintenance. 1. Product Overview Important : Never open the ZXD 3000 case
The ZXD 3000 (often categorized under the V5.0 or V5.5 series) is a switching mode rectifier (SMR) that converts AC input into stable DC output. Key Features:
High Efficiency: Often exceeding 90% peak efficiency to reduce operational costs.
Wide Input Voltage: Operates reliably across a broad range of AC inputs (typically 85V AC to 295V AC).
Hot-Pluggable: Can be inserted or removed without powering down the entire system.
CAN Communication: Uses a Controller Area Network (CAN) interface for seamless integration with monitoring units. 2. Technical Specifications
Understanding the limits of your hardware is critical for safety. Specification Input Voltage 100V – 240V AC (Nominal) Output Voltage 42V – 58V DC (Adjustable) Maximum Output Power Cooling Forced air cooling (Internal Fan) Operating Temperature -40°C to +75°C (Derating may apply) 3. Installation Steps Before installation, ensure the AC breaker is switched off.
Check for Damage: Inspect the pins on the back of the module to ensure they are straight and clean.
Alignment: Align the ZXD 3000 module with the empty slot in the power rack.
Insertion: Gently slide the module into the slot until the connectors are fully seated.
Securing: Tighten the front panel screws or engage the locking latch (depending on your specific chassis model).
Power On: Switch on the AC supply. The "Run" LED should begin to blink or remain steady green. 4. LED Indicator Meanings
The front panel typically features three LED indicators. Understanding these is the quickest way to diagnose the unit's status: Run (Green): Steady: Normal operation. Flashing: Communication established with the controller. Alarm (Yellow):
Steady: Indicates a non-critical fault (e.g., high temperature or input over/under voltage). The unit may still be functional but at a limited capacity. Fault (Red):
Steady: Critical failure (e.g., output over-voltage or internal fan failure). The module will usually shut down to protect the system. 5. Maintenance and Troubleshooting
The ZXD 3000 is designed for low maintenance, but dust is its primary enemy. Common Issues:
Module won’t power on: Check the AC input voltage at the rack and ensure the module is fully seated in the slot.
Fan Noise/Failure: If the Red LED is on and the fan isn't spinning, the fan unit likely needs replacement.
Overheating: Ensure the front intake and rear exhaust vents are not blocked. Clean dust filters regularly.
Use compressed air to blow out dust from the front grille. Do not use liquids or conductive brushes inside the unit. 6. Safety Warnings
High Voltage: Even after disconnecting, internal capacitors can hold a charge. Wait at least 5 minutes before opening the casing.
Professional Service: There are no user-serviceable parts inside the module casing. Opening the unit usually voids the warranty.
